Sanborn County, South Dakota Sanborn County is a county located in the U.S. state of South Dakota. As of the 2010 census, the population was 2,355. Its county seat is Woonsocket. (...) Redstone Creek (South Dakota) Redstone Creek is a stream in Clark, Kingsbury, Miner and Sanborn counties in the U.S. state of South Dakota. Redstone Creek was named for the reddish tint of the rock within its watercourse. (...) South Dakota Dept. of Transportation Bridge No. 56-090-096 South Dakota Dept. of Transportation Bridge No. 56-090-096, near Forestburg in Sanborn County, South Dakota, is a Warren pony truss bridge built by the Iowa Bridge Company in 1912.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1993. It brought a local road across Sand Creek (...)
